Abstract

This study was aimed to investigate effect of National Examination (UN) and curriculum also their interaction effect on students’ performance in solving TIMSS model Mathematics problems. This study was carried out with 300 8th graders of East Kalimantan students. The participants were from three mathematic National Examination result school categories on 2016 (low, moderate and high) and two implemented curriculum types (KTSP and Currciculum 2013). Data collection used 28 items TIMSS model Mathematics problems (α = 0.837) which contained content and cognitive domain. Data analysis used two ways analysis of variance. Data analysis revealed that there were significance main effect of national examination and curriculums, also interaction  effect between of them on mathematic achievement. There were significance main effect of national examination and curriculums on content domain. But, there was no significance interaction effect between of them on performance in solving geometry. There were significance main effect of national examination and curriculums on cognitive domain. But, there was no significance interaction effect between of them on knowing thinking level.

Abstract

Environmental literacy (EL) must be implanted in education, including at the Islamic Boarding School. This study aimed to analyze the EL of students (focus on ecological knowledge/EK, verbal commitment/VC, and actual commitment/AC) in MA Bilingual-Sidoarjo. The approach used was a quantitative approach, supported by qualitative data. This research was ex-post facto, for three months. The research subjects were 120 students (40 each grade), taken by purposive sampling. EL was assessed using MSELS/I. The analysis was carried out by tabulating it into Microsoft Excel 2010. The results showed various EL scores. The aspects of EK vary, from sufficient to high levels. Students in class XI and XII-IPA have a relatively high EK score, while students of class X-IPS have low score. The distribution of students' EK scores in one class group was very diverse. Students tend to have an attitude (VK) that agrees to take pro-environmental actions, especially on small things, but the opposite in terms related to the system and the involvement of many people. At the level of behavior (AC), students tend to show pro-environmental actions. Thus it can be concluded that EL students tend to be diverse, tend to increase their quality according to class level.

Abstract

This study aimed at determining whether the PBL model and learning styles could influence the students' mathematical problem-solving and self-esteem abilities. This study was a quasi-experimental study, in which in include of two classes namely X MIPA 1 class (Mathematics and Natural Sciences); moreover, there were 24 students who used the PBL learning model as an experimental class and X MIPA 2 (Mathematics and Natural Sciences) that consisted of 22 students used a scientific learning model as a control class at SMAN 17 Pandeglang on the academic year of 2019/2020. In addition to the learning model, the students were also categorized based on visual, auditory, and kinesthetic learning styles. The data were collected by means of learning style questionnaires, problem-solving ability test, and self-esteem questionnaires. The data analysis was performed statistically both descriptive and inferential. The validity of mathematical problems was based on the expert assessment and validity test while the reliability was tested using product moment correlation. Pre-test and post-test data had been tested and both of them were homogeneous and normally distributed. The homogeneity test used Lavene test and the normality test used Chi Square. The influence test was performed using statistics, the average difference test, the two-way ANOVA test, and the Post Hoc follow-up test with Scheffe. All data were processed using SPSS. This study indicated the success by obtaining a significant value of 0.00 <α. Hence, it can be concluded that there is an effect of the implementation of PBL models and learning styles on mathematical problem-solving and self-esteem abilities.

Abstract

This study aimed at discovering the implementation of MODis-ARCS strategy to students’ verbal communication skill and learning outcomes. This study was a quasi-experimental using non- equivalent control group design. Purposive sampling was used to collect the data. There were 65 students of information technology education (control) and physics education (experimental) who used as the samples of study. The MODis-ARCS strategy was implemented on the experimental group, while small group discussion was used in the control group. Data collection techniques used test instrument that was in the form of essay items and non-test which was in the form of observation sheets of communication skill. Validity scores, Cronbach’s coefficient alpha, n-gain, independent sample t-test and paired t-test were used as the data analysis techniques. The results of study indicated that 1) n-gain of students’ learning outcomes and verbal communication skill for the control group was 0.12 and 0.07, in which it was categorized as low, while for the experimental group was 0.29 and 0.48 in the moderate category. 2) Both of groups had similar initial abilities, and there was a difference on the learning outcomes, as well as the verbal communication skill between the control and experimental classes, 3) There was an improvement on the students’ learning outcomes and verbal communication skill on the control and experimental groups, in which the significance value was ɑ=5%; however, the improvement of experimental group was greater than the control group. Therefore, it can be concluded that the MODis-ARCS strategy can improve the students’ verbal communication skill and learning outcomes.

Abstract

This study aimed at analyzing the effect of guided inquiry learning to the metacognitive ability of primary school students on the material of Least Common Multiple (KPK) and Greatest Common Divisor (FPB). The type of study was a mixed-method using quantitative and qualitative methods. There were 55 students of 4th grade used as the subjects of study. Two learning models were compared, namely guided inquiry learning model and conventional learning model. The students’ metacognitive ability was measured by means of problem-solving test on the material of Least Common Multiple (KPK) and Greatest Common Divisor (FPB). The quantitative analysis data used descriptive and inferential statistical tests. According to the results of data analysis, it was discovered that the t-test of sig (2-tailed) from the independent samples t-test of post-test was 0,00 (p = <0,05); this indicated that there was a significant difference on it. This showed that there was a difference of students’ metacognitive ability for both classes in solving the problems of Least Common Multiple (KPK) and Greatest Common Divisor (FPB) after the guided inquiry learning was implemented. Consequently, it can be concluded that there is a significant effect on the implementation of guided inquiry learning model to improve the students’ metacognitive ability in solving the material problems of Least Common Multiple (KPK) and Greatest Common Divisor (FPB).

Abstract

This study aimed to develop a test instrument to measure students' critical thinking skills on fluid material.  Characteristics of the instrument and its validity estimation are also described. This research and development study employed five stages of research, namely information collecting (literature review and preparation of the subject matter), planning (defining and formulating objectives), developing preliminary form of the test instrument, preliminary field testing (expert validation), and main product revision (in accordance with the recommendations in the preliminary field testing). The content and construct validity were estimated by expert validation. Results of the instrument validation showed average scores for each component (content validity index of 4.63 and construct validity of 4.75), both of which are in the very valid category. The final result of the instrument validation is 4.69 (very valid if: Va > 4.21), with 98.7% reliability. Description of the study result is presented further in this article.
